He served as a missionary for the Reorganized Church of Jesus Christ of Latter Day Saints in Hawaii from 1890 until November 1938 when he left for California. Although described as an autobiography on the title page, this work is actually a history of the Reorganized Church in the Hawaiian Islands, written by Waller.
